Drexel Hamilton analyst, Brian White, reiterated his Buy rating on shares of Apple (NASDAQ: AAPL) ahead of Apple's announcement tomorrow that will focus on the unveiling of the iPhone 7/7 Plus, combined with potential other announcements (e.g., Apple Watch 2, Beats).
The analyst stated "Similar to the summer of 2013, we believe this summer will prove to be a bottoming process for Apple's stock with our estimates reflecting that the sales and profit cycle troughed in 3Q:FY16. Moreover, recent run-ins with the FBI, China Government, EU and short sellers has made Apple the "Jason Bourne of Tech". Similarly, just as the market calls for Apple's undoing, the company emerges even stronger."
No change to the price target of $185.

Shares of Apple closed at $107.73 yesterday.
